The garage occupancy feed for the Brindlewood campus arrives over a message queue every thirty seconds, one record per level, published by the Stallgrid edge boxes. Counts can briefly go negative when a sensor double-fires on exit; the ingest job clamps these to zero and flags the interval. If the feed stalls for more than five minutes, the dashboard falls back to the last known snapshot. Sensor mappings, queue names, and the replay procedure are documented on the internal page below.

runbook for tahog-kadug: https://gitlab.qirvanworks.corp/projects/pages/view/b139298aed28

- [ ] **Step 7: Breaker override escrow.** After sealing the signing keys for the Tallgrove upstream API circuit breaker, confirm the support team can force the breaker open during a full outage. The override bundle lives in the sealed escrow drawer and is useless without its unlock phrase. Two ceremony witnesses must initial this step before proceeding. The escrow bundle is decrypted with the recovery passphrase that follows.

vault phrase of kahip-kahop = holath-quenmir

**Vendor note: Inkmill markdown pipeline**

Rendering for Parchway docs is outsourced to Inkmill under an annual contract, renewing each March. They handle sanitization and PDF export; we own the upload queue. SLA: 4-hour response on rendering failures. Escalate only after two failed retries. Their support desk is reachable at the address below.

billing contact of hahaf-baguf = zorael.tammir.jorius@sivrelhq.internal

Before the report scheduler can pull odometer and pump data, the service needs its environment file at /opt/haulmetric/report.env populated. Set FUEL_REGION to the depot cluster (e.g., northyard or easton), REPORT_DAY to an ISO weekday number, and SMTP_RELAY to the internal relay hostname. All three are plain values and safe to share in tickets. The final entry authenticates against the telematics gateway and must never be pasted into support chats. Append that line directly below.

secret setting of yagef-baweg: RELAY_SECRET29=cb53deb59a49ed54d9f43599b54ca